Understanding OEM and ODM in Yoga Leggings Manufacturing

What is OEM?

OEM (Original Equipment Manufacturing) involves producing yoga leggings based on the buyer's specifications. In this model, the buyer provides the design, materials, and sometimes even the manufacturing process details. The manufacturer, such as luckyyoga, executes the production to meet the exact requirements. This option is ideal for brands that have a clear vision and want to maintain control over the design and quality.

What is ODM?

ODM (Original Design Manufacturing) means the manufacturer offers pre-designed products that the buyer can customize. For luckylifegear Yoga Leggings Manufacturing Part 124, ODM services allow brands to choose from a range of existing designs, fabrics, and features, then add their branding. This is a cost-effective and time-saving option for companies looking to quickly launch a product line without extensive design work.

Key Differences and Benefits

  • Control: OEM provides more control over the final product, while ODM offers less customization but faster turnaround.
  • Cost: OEM may involve higher upfront costs due to custom tooling and sampling, whereas ODM often has lower initial investment.
  • Time: ODM is typically faster because the design is already developed.

    MOQ (Minimum Order Quantity) in Yoga Leggings Manufacturing

    What is MOQ?

    MOQ stands for Minimum Order Quantity – the smallest number of units a manufacturer will produce in a single order. In the yoga leggings industry, MOQs can vary significantly based on the manufacturer's capabilities and the complexity of the design.

    Typical MOQ Ranges

  • Standard MOQ: Many manufacturers, including luckyyoga, have a standard MOQ of 300 to 500 pieces per color and size combination. This is common for OEM orders.
  • Low MOQ: Some manufacturers offer low MOQs (as low as 50-100 pieces) for startups or small brands, but this often comes with higher per-unit costs.
  • High MOQ: For large-scale productions, MOQs can be in the thousands, which reduces the cost per unit.

    Quality Control in Yoga Leggings Manufacturing

    Importance of Quality Control

    Quality control (QC) is a critical aspect of yoga leggings manufacturing. Poor quality can lead to returns, damaged brand reputation, and financial losses. Implementing robust QC measures ensures that every pair of leggings meets the required standards for stitching, fabric, and overall finish.

    Key Quality Control Steps

  • Incoming Material Inspection: Check the quality of fabrics, threads, and other raw materials before production begins.
  • In-Process Inspection: Monitor the production line to catch defects early, such as stitching errors or color inconsistencies.
  • Final Inspection: Conduct a thorough check of finished products, including sizing, seams, and overall aesthetics.
  • Testing: Perform fabric tests for elasticity, colorfastness, and pilling resistance to ensure durability.

    Common Quality Issues and How to Avoid Them

  • Seam splitting: Use high-quality thread and proper stitching techniques.
  • Color fading: Choose premium dyes and conduct washing tests.
  • Inconsistent sizing: Implement accurate measurement and grading systems.
  • Fabric pilling: Select fabrics with high resistance to abrasion.
  • Manufacturing Process Overview

    Step-by-Step Production

  • Design and Sampling: Create prototypes for approval.
  • Fabric Sourcing: Select suitable materials (e.g., nylon, spandex, polyester).
  • Cutting: Precisely cut fabric pieces according to patterns.
  • Sewing: Assemble the pieces using specialized machines.
  • Quality Check: Inspect each garment for defects.
  • Packing: Fold, label, and package the leggings for shipment.
